Announcement

Collapse
No announcement yet.

Rollback to

Collapse
X
  • Filter
  • Time
  • Show
Clear All
new posts

  • Rollback to

    Hallo Zusammen,

    ich habe in meinen Programm einen "SAVEPOINT" deklariert und führe im Fehlerfall einen "ROLLBACK TO" zu diesem "SAVEPOINT" aus.
    Ich erwarte nun, dass Oracle die Datenbankänderungen seit dem letzten
    SAVEPOINT rückgängig macht, was auch funktioniert.
    Ich habe jeodch feststellen müssen, dass alle andere Änderungen vor
    dem ROLLBACK comittet wurden.

    Führt ein ROLLBACK TO bzw. der SAVEPOINT eine automatischen COMMIT aus ?

  • #2
    kurz und knapp: nein

    solltest Du jedoch in Deinem Programmcode DDL Statements verwenden, so führen diese selbstverfreilich zu einem commit.

    Comment

    Working...
    X